in a game of poker, five players are each dealt 5 cards from a 52-card deck. how many ways are there to deal the cards?
Jlenok [28]

The number of ways to deal 5 cards to 5 players from a 52-card deck in a game of poker is (52!)/[(27!)*(5!)^5].

  • Permutations and combinations define nCr as ways of selecting 'r' number of items from 'n' items. 
  • nCr = (n!)/[r!(n-r)!]
  • here we want to deal 5 playing cards to each player.once we deal 5 playing cards to any participant,
  • the playing cards left inside the deck are reduced through five.
  • We deal a total of 25 playing cards, i.e., 5 playing cards to 5 gamers.
  • The number of ways to deal five playing cards to the primary participant is 52C5.The number of approaches to deal 5 playing cards to the second one participant is 47C5.
  • The wide variety of ways to deal 5 cards to the 0.33 player is 42C5.
  • The variety of methods to deal 5 cards to the fourth participant is 37C5.
  • The quantity of ways to deal 5 playing cards to the 5th player is 32C5.
  • the full quantity of methods is the general multiplication.
  • The total number of solutions = 52C5 * 47C5 * 42C5 * 37C5 * 32C5
  • When we simplify, we get (52!)/[(27!)*(5!)^5].
